# SPDX-License-Identifier: (GPL-2.0-only OR BSD-2-Clause)
%YAML 1.2
---
$id: http://devicetree.org/schemas/net/renesas,ethertsn.yaml#
$schema: http://devicetree.org/meta-schemas/core.yaml#

title: Renesas Ethernet TSN End-station

maintainers:
  - Niklas Söderlund <niklas.soderlund@ragnatech.se>

description:
  The RTSN device provides Ethernet network using a 10 Mbps, 100 Mbps, or 1
  Gbps full-duplex link via MII/GMII/RMII/RGMII. Depending on the connected PHY.

allOf:
  - $ref: ethernet-controller.yaml#

properties:
  compatible:
    items:
      - enum:
          - renesas,r8a779g0-ethertsn       # R-Car V4H
      - const: renesas,rcar-gen4-ethertsn

  reg:
    items:
      - description: TSN End Station target
      - description: generalized Precision Time Protocol target

  reg-names:
    items:
      - const: tsnes
      - const: gptp

  interrupts:
    items:
      - description: TX data interrupt
      - description: RX data interrupt

  interrupt-names:
    items:
      - const: tx
      - const: rx

  clocks:
    maxItems: 1

  power-domains:
    maxItems: 1

  resets:
    maxItems: 1

  phy-mode:
    contains:
      enum:
        - mii
        - rgmii

  phy-handle:
    $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/phandle
    description:
      Specifies a reference to a node representing a PHY device.

  rx-internal-delay-ps:
    enum: [0, 1800]
    default: 0

  tx-internal-delay-ps:
